Ask Me Now is a vocal jazz ensemble led by Frances Rahaim, with Dominic Poccia and James Argiro.

The group performs most often as a drummerless quartet or trio, expanding thoughtfully with trusted collaborators based on venue, repertoire, and availability.

The vocal group adopted its moniker from the Monk tune of the same title. We are proud to present music from a wide variety of jazz, blues, Latin, and pop greats—ranging from Sarah Vaughan, Fats Waller, Duke Ellington, and Diana Krall to Cole Porter, Thelonious Monk, Ella Fitzgerald, Billie Holiday, Stevie Wonder, Horace Silver, and many more.

The band specializes in delivering interesting arrangements and treatments to time-tested favorites and lesser-known gems. We believe great music is timeless.
